Avalon are working wityh a social housing provider to appoint an experienced Building Surveyor to join its property team.
Benefits * 30 days annual leave and enhanced pension contribution * Performance-related bonus and private healthcare * Car allowance * Flexible and hybrid working The Role This is an excellent opportunity for a technically strong and commercially aware professional to work across a varied property portfolio.
You will support the delivery of reactive maintenance, planned investment and property improvement works, ensuring projects are delivered efficiently, safely and to a high standard.
Working closely with colleagues, contractors and external stakeholders, you will provide professional surveying advice and help ensure properties are maintained effectively while supporting wider compliance and investment objectives.
Key Responsibilities As a Building Surveyor, you will: * Manage reactive maintenance, property improvement works, inspections and condition surveys. * Support stock condition programmes, void management, contractor procurement and tendering. * Assist with contract administration, project management, specifications and technical reporting. * Work with internal teams and contractors to maintain quality, safety, compliance and value for money.
